To the Muse So you’re back again, like a divorced husband or spoilt mistress demanding my attention. I thought you’d lost my address. Did you find it again in a wine-stained diary? a Facebook reminder? or a sip of tea and taste of madeleine? What makes you think I have time for you these days? Was it the fact that I lie awake through the night that gave you the space to step behind my eyes? Or have I been harbouring you all this time in my blood, jostling the malaria, and waiting like it to rise…
